Witryna3 wrz 2024 · Is Spanish spoken in the Philippines? But by 1987, Spanish in the Philippines was de-listed as a co-official language, alongside English and Filipino. Currently only about 0.5 per cent of the Philippines’ 100 million-strong population speaks Spanish; however, it’s still home to the most number of Spanish speakers in Asia. Arabic Zobacz więcej • Philippines portal • Languages portal • Filipino alphabet • Filipino orthography Zobacz więcej • Linguistic map of the Philippines at Muturzikin.com • Ricardo Maria Nolasco on the diversity of languages in the Philippines Zobacz więcej Spanish was the language of government, education and trade throughout the three centuries (333 years) of the Philippines being part of the Spanish Empire and continued to serve as a lingua franca until the first half of the 20th century. It was first introduced to the Philippines in 1565, when the conquistador Miguel López de Legazpi founded the first Spanish settlement on the island of Cebú.
